Cold storage wallets for crypto often referred to as cold wallets or offline wallets, are used to store cryptocurrencies offline to safeguard them from hacking and other forms of cyber-crime. They are typically considered to be the safest option to store cryptocurrency because they aren’t associated with the web, which means they cannot be accessed by hackers.
There are several types of cold storage wallets for crypto, including paper wallets, hardware wallets and offline wallets. Each type has its own advantages and disadvantages, and the most suitable choice for each person will be based on their particular requirements as well as the amount of money they are seeking to store.
Hardware wallets are devices that are used to store cryptocurrencies offline. They are usually compact, lightweight and simple to use. A few popular options for hardware wallets are those like the Ledger Nano S and Trezor. Hardware wallets are considered to be the most secure kind of cold storage wallet, as they are not tied to the web, and are therefore not vulnerable to hacking. They are also simple to use and can be utilized to store a broad variety of different cryptocurrency.
Paper wallets are another popular cold storage option. They are made by printing a private and public key onto a piece paper, which is then kept in a secure location. Paper wallets are thought to be among the most secure cold storage options, as they are not connected to the internet and therefore in no danger of being hacked. But, they could be damaged or lost, and they aren’t as user-friendly as hardware wallets.
Offline software wallets are digital wallets that are installed on a PC or other device and can be utilized offline. They are thought to be more secure than online wallets, as they do not connect to the internet and therefore less susceptible to hacking. But, they’re not as secure as traditional wallets and are susceptible to malware and other forms of cyber attack.
